Output 856bc27d114535a6b863a7a84d151f2bb285aa38b67f5a39e99f9077d0c9e515:1

value
26826600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3e1d20bf914676a81be843f58e3dccb4a7d92e21 OP_EQUALVERIFY OP_CHECKSIG
address
16fRnjkUk3MdyNpTa3dLmbZrquxRCtybUx
transaction
856bc27d114535a6b863a7a84d151f2bb285aa38b67f5a39e99f9077d0c9e515
spent
true